- The distance between Batesville, Ms, Usa and Port Angeles, Wa, Usa is approximately 3,143 km or 1,953 mi.
- To reach Batesville, Ms in this distance one would set out from Port Angeles, Wa bearing 107.5°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Batesville, Ms bearing 129.7° or SE .
- Batesville, Ms has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Port Angeles, Wa has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b).
- The average annual temperature is 6.1 °C (11°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.5 °C (20.7°F) more in Batesville, Ms.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 820.3 mm (32.3 in) more which is equivalent to 820.3 l/m² (20.13 US gal/ft²) or 8,203,000 l/ha (876,955 US gal/ac) more. About 2 2/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 14° higher in Batesville, Ms than in Port Angeles, Wa.
